@charset "utf-8";
/* CSS Document */
.zone-desc {border-bottom:1px solid #decbaf;font-size:0;}
.zone-desc .format {position:relative;display:inline-block;width:0.97rem;height:0.23rem;border-bottom:0.1rem solid #f5f5f5;color:transparent;background:url("http://www.huangpu.org.cn/images/zone_desc_bgs_site2020.png") left -2.76rem;background-size:auto 6.21rem;}
.zone-desc .format:before {position:absolute;left:0;bottom:-0.11rem;content:"";display:block;width:100%;height:0.02rem;background:#6b3912;}
.zone-desc+* {margin-top:0.1rem;}
.type1 .zone-desc .format {background-position:left -4.37rem;}
.type2 .zone-desc .format {background-position:left -4.6rem;}
.type3 .zone-desc .format {background-position:left -4.83rem;}
.type4 .zone-desc .format {width:1.23rem;background-position:left -5.06rem;}
.type5 .zone-desc .format {width:2.23rem;background-position:left -5.29rem;}
.type6 .zone-desc .format {background-position:left -0.46rem;}
.type7 .zone-desc .format {background-position:left -2.07rem;}
/* types_begin */
.type1 .content {padding:0.28rem 0.17rem;;font-size:0.16rem;line-height:1.75em;background:#fff;}
.type1 .content a {max-height:5.25em;}
.type2 .list-item {float:left;}
.type2 .list-item:nth-of-type(n+2) {margin-left:0.1466rem;}
.type2 img {width:1.13rem;height:1.52rem;border:0.04rem solid #cdae7d;}
.type3 .list-item {float:left;margin-left:0.225rem;}
.type3 .list-item:nth-of-type(3n+1) {margin-left:0;}
.type3 .list-item:nth-of-type(n+4) {margin-top:0.13rem;}
.type3 img {width:1.61rem;height:0.91rem;}
.type4 .list,.type5 .list {border:0.01rem solid #dcbe9f;background:#fff;}
.type4 .list {padding:0.09rem 0.17rem 0.21rem;}
.type4 .list-item {float:left;margin-top:0.11rem;margin-left:0.07rem;}
.type4 .list-item:nth-of-type(9n+1) {margin-left:0;}
.type5 .list {padding:0.09rem 0.17rem 0.21rem;}
.type5 .list-item {font-size:0;margin-top:0.11rem;}
.type5 .list-item-title,.type5 .sub-list,.type5 .sub-list-item {display:inline-block;vertical-align:top;}
.type5 .list-item-title,.type5 .sub-list-item {font-size:0.16rem;line-height:1.5em;}
.type5 .sub-list {max-width:4.28rem;}
.type5 .sub-list-item {margin-right:0.38rem;}
.type6 .list {padding:0.19rem 0.21rem 0.2rem;background:#ddcaad;}
.type6 .list-item {float:left;}
.type6 .list-item:nth-of-type(even) {margin-left:0.12rem;}
.type6 img {width:1.66rem;height:3.32rem;}
.type7 {margin-top:0.48rem;}
.type7 .list {padding:0.09rem 0.21rem 0.31rem;border:0.01rem solid #dcbe9f;background:#fff;}
.type7 .list-item {float:left;margin:0.1rem 0.09rem 0;font-size:0.18rem;line-height:1.5em;}
.type7 .list-item a {color:#423e4c;}
.type8 {margin-top:0.31rem;}
.type8 img {width:3.86rem;height:0.96rem;}
.type8 .list-item:nth-of-type(n+2) {margin-top:0.11rem;}
/* types_end */
.main {margin-top:0.4rem;}
.main .wrap {background:none;}
.left-side,.middle,.right-side {float:left;}
.middle,.right-side {margin-left:0.5rem;}
.right-side {width:3.86rem;}
.middle .item {margin-top:0.39rem;}
.middle .item:nth-child(1) {margin-top:0;}
.bottom {position:relative;clear:both;border-top:0.38rem solid transparent;}
.left-side .list-item {width:1.82rem;height:0.9rem;border:0.02rem solid #aa968e;}
.left-side .list-item:nth-of-type(n+2) {margin-top:0.15rem;}
.left-side .list-item a {width:100%;height:0.22rem;border:1px solid #f0e7d8;border-width:0.34rem 0;text-indent:-100%;background:#f0e7d8 url("http://www.huangpu.org.cn/images/titls_bgs_site2020.png") center top no-repeat;background-size:auto 2.57rem;overflow:hidden;}
.left-side .list-item:nth-of-type(2) a {background-position:center -0.23rem;}
.left-side .list-item:nth-of-type(3) a {background-position:center -0.46rem;}
.left-side .list-item:nth-of-type(4) a {background-position:center -0.69rem;}
.left-side .list-item:nth-of-type(5) a {background-position:center -0.92rem;}
.left-side .list-item:nth-of-type(6) a {background-position:center -1.15rem;}
.left-side .list-item:nth-of-type(7) a {background-position:center -1.38rem;}
.left-side .list-item:nth-of-type(8) a {background-position:center -1.61rem;}
.left-side .list-item:nth-of-type(9) a {height:0.5rem;border-width:0.2rem 0;background-position:center -1.83rem;}
.left-side .list-item:nth-of-type(10) a {background-position:center bottom;}
.middle .item {width:5.28rem;}
.bottom .zone-desc+* {margin-top:0;}
.bottom .zone-desc {position:absolute;width:0.48rem;height:100%;font-size:0.22rem;color:#f0e7d8;background:#78564a;}
.bottom .zone-desc .format {position:static;display:block;width:1.5em;height:100%;margin:0 auto;border:none;writing-mode:vertical-lr;text-align:center;letter-spacing:0.4em;color:#f0e7d8;background:none;}
.bottom .zone-desc .format:before {bottom:0;height:100%;background:transparent;}
.bottom .list {margin-left:0.61rem;}
.bottom .list-item {float:left;width:2.17rem;margin-left:0.135rem;}
.bottom .list-item:first-child {margin-left:0;}
.bottom img {width:2.17rem;height:1.22rem;}
.bottom .list-item-title {line-height:1em;}
.bottom .list-item-title a {border-top:0.14rem solid transparent;}
/* ////////////////////////////////////////////////// */
/* for hover_begin */
@media screen and (min-width:1200px){
.item .list-item:hover a {color:#cdae7d;}
.type5 .list-item:hover a {color:#000;}
.type5 .sub-list-item:hover a {color:#cdae7d;}
}
/* for hover_end */
@media screen and (max-width:1199px){
.type4 .list-item,.type4 .list-item:nth-of-type(6n+1),.type5 .list-item {margin:0.11rem 0.17rem 0;}
}
@media screen and (max-width:768px){
.left-side, .middle, .right-side {float:none;margin:0 auto;}
.middle {margin-top:0.4rem;}
.right-side {display:none;}
.left-side .list-item,.left-side .list-item:nth-of-type(n+2) {float:left;margin-top:0.01rem;margin-left:0.01rem;}
.middle .item {width:auto;}
.type1 .content,.type4,.type5 .list-item-title,.type5 .sub-list-item,.bottom .list-item-title {font-size:16px;}
.type2 .list-item:nth-of-type(n+2) {margin-left:0.1rem;}
.type2 img {width:1.715rem;height:2.3rem;}
.type3 .list-item {margin-top:0.13rem;}
.type3 .list-item:nth-of-type(3n+1) {margin-left:0.225rem;}
.bottom .zone-desc {font-size:22px;}
.bottom .list-item:nth-of-type(n+4) {margin-top:0.2rem;}
.bottom .list-item:nth-of-type(3n+1) {margin-left:0;}
}
@media screen and (max-width:480px){
.left-side .list-item,.left-side .list-item:nth-of-type(n+2) {margin:0 0.22rem;}
.left-side .list-item:nth-of-type(n+3) {margin-top:0.1rem;}
.type2 .list-item,.type2 .list-item:nth-of-type(n+2) {margin:0 0.25rem;}
.type2 .list-item:nth-of-type(n+3) {margin-top:0.1rem;}
.type3 .list-item {margin:0.1rem 0.25rem 0;}
.type3 img {width:1.8rem;height:1.01rem;}
.type5 .sub-list {max-width:calc(100% - 64px);}
.bottom .zone-desc,.bottom .zone-desc .format {position:static;width:auto;}
.bottom .zone-desc .format {writing-mode:horizontal-tb;}
.bottom .zone-desc .format:before {display:none;}
.bottom .list {margin:0 auto;}
.bottom .list-item,.bottom .list-item:nth-of-type(3n+1) {margin-top:0.2rem;margin-left:0.26rem;}
.bottom .list-item:nth-of-type(n+2) {margin-top:0.2rem;}
.bottom .list-item:nth-of-type(odd) {margin-left:0;}
}
@media screen and (max-width:360px){
}